Otocinclus catfish, or "Otos," are small, peaceful, herbivorous South American fish popular for algae eating, though they are not recommended for beginner aquarists because they can be sensitive and are prone to starvation in new tanks. They should be kept in groups of four to six or more and need a mature aquarium with a constant supply of biofilm and algae. Supplement their diet with algae wafers and blanched vegetables, and provide clean water with temperatures between 68 and 77
